2010年9月2日 星期四

新奇-35年CPU時間證實解開魔術方塊為20步 稱之為「God's number」



魔術方塊一個經典的玩具,從1974年誕生到現在為止已經風靡全球。這種玩具的最大魅力就在於將每一面的顏色打亂之後,可以形成數目驚人的顏色組合,一個3×3×3魔術方塊最多可以形成的組合數在理論上超過4325億億種。解魔術方塊也逐漸成為了數學家們的研究項目,最少需要多少次轉動可以確保無論什麼樣的顏色組合都能被覆原?這成為了一些數學家求證的難題,而最終答案也被稱為「神的步數」(God's number)。近日有研究小組宣佈,「神的步數」研究已經有了新的進展,目前這個數字被定格到20。也就是說,無論什麼樣組合的三階魔術方塊,都可以在20步內被解開。這個數字是使用了由Google捐贈的閒置CPU資源進行計算的,總共花費CPU時間約為35年。研究者們將4325億億種初始組合狀態分為了2,217,093,120組,然後再利用對稱性集合覆蓋將總狀態縮小至55,882,296組,在計算機上運行的解魔術方塊算法可以在20秒內還原一組,最後完成整個工程大約耗費了35年的CPU時間。早在1981年的時候,「神的步數」被證明為52,在1995年降低至29,之後的每次突破都非常困難。不過這對於普通玩家來說,20步還原一個三階魔術方塊應該還是一件不可能的任務吧!!

沒有留言:

張貼留言